Palghar
Palghar is a village located in Mandangad tehsil of Ratnagiri district in Maharashtra, India. It is situated 35km away from sub-district headquarter Mandangad (tehsildar office) and 180km away from district headquarter Ratnagiri. As per 2009 stats, Palghar village is also a gram panchayat.

About Palghar
According to Census 2011, the location code or village code of Palghar is 564773. The village spans a total geographical area of 290.48 hectares. Khed is nearest town to Palghar village for all major economic activities, which is approximately 35km away.
When it comes to local governance, Palghar village is administered by a Sarpanch, the elected head of the village, in accordance with the Constitution of India and the Panchayati Raj Act. The village falls under the Dapoli Vidhan Sabha constituency for state-level representation and the Raigad Lok Sabha constituency for national parliamentary elections. Population of Palghar
Below is a concise population overview of Palghar as per the Census 2011 data. The table highlights the key population metrics categorized by gender and social groups.
Particulars | Total | Male | Female |
---|---|---|---|
Total Population | 568 | 243 | 325 |
Child Population (0–6 yrs) | 47 | 21 | 26 |
Scheduled Castes (SC) | 33 | 10 | 23 |
Scheduled Tribes (ST) | 7 | 4 | 3 |
Literate Population | 429 | 203 | 226 |
Illiterate Population | 139 | 40 | 99 |
Here's a detailed summary of the Basic Population Details of Palghar village:
- The total population of Palghar village is around 568, including approximately 243 males and 325 females, with a sex ratio of 1337 females per 1,000 males.
- There are about 47 children aged 0–6 years in Palghar village, reflecting the young population in the village.
- Palghar village has 33 people belonging to the Scheduled Castes (SC) and 7 residents from the Scheduled Tribes (ST).
- The literacy rate of Palghar village is about 75.53%, with male literacy at 83.54% and female literacy at 69.54%.
- There are around 144 households in Palghar village.
Connectivity of Palghar
Connectivity plays a major role in improving access, opportunities, and overall development of villages like Palghar. As per the 2011 stats, Palghar had access to public bus service, private bus service and railway station.
Connectivity Type | Status (in year 2011) |
---|---|
Public Bus Service | Available within village |
Private Bus Service | Available within 5 - 10 km distance |
Railway Station | Available within 10+ km distance |
